1956 Porsche 356A 1500GS Carrera Speedster ⢠VIN 82XXX ⢠Engine No. 90602 ⢠Transmission No. 8225 - Matching ⢠Production Date February 17, 1956 According to the Porsche Kardex, this Carrera GS Speedster was a US delivery that was imported by Hoffman Motors. Originally finished in White (color code 603) over Red leatherette interior with factory equipment included sealed beam headlights and speedometer in miles. Extremely rare and highly collectible Carrera 4-Cam Speedster, the 21st of only 74 GS Speedsters produced from 1955-1958, which is verified through the Carrera book by Steve Heinrichs and Rolf Sprenger. Eligible for exclusive vintage rallies such as the Mille Miglia, California Mille, Copper State, SCM Tour, and the Colorado Grand. This 1956 Porsche 1500GS Carrera Speedster was owned by a collector who had owned this 356 for over four decades in the Midwest. He had a large collection of Porsches and parts. The Carrera Speedster had been sitting with 20 other Porsche projects in storage and had not been moved in over 35 years. A broker purchased the Carrera Speedster from the collector, and it was offered to European Collectibles. After verifying it was an original GS Speedster, European Collectibles purchased the 356 and completed a full Concours restoration. Since its restoration in 2017, this Carrera Speedster has been shown four times. It won first in class at every event. In 2018, it was purchased by a Southern California Porsche collector in Beverly Hills who had a prominent collection of Speedsters. European Collectibles performed a no expense spared, full Concour restoration on this 1956 Porsche 1500GS Carrera Speedster over a 28-month period from 2015 to 2017. During the restoration, this 356 was completely disassembled and stripped down to the bare shell so that every aspect could be properly addressed.
